Application to display top-k hashtags over a sliding window of tweets. User is given the option to subscribe for particular keywords.
-
The sliding window contains the latest tweets seen over last few units of time or contains the last N tweets. In this application I have made the assumption that the window refers to the window of latest N tweets. Hence whenever N+1 tweet comes, the first tweet is removed.
-
The application is built with the assumption that the user has the required credentials to subscribe for tweets. These include: CONSUMER KEY, CONSUMER SECRET, ACCESS TOKEN, ACCESS TOKEN SECRET.
-
An assumption that sometimes the user may want to subscribe for tweets with particular keywords and see the top-k hashtags for those topics, is made. However, if user has no preference it is still possible to indicate that and subscribe for tweets.
-
This is a simple application to show how stream processing is done.
-
The application is developed as a maven project and can be run on Eclipse or command-line.
-
The application is designed to run forever until the user manually ends it.

User is asked to enter the credentials required to establish a twitter stream connection.
-
User is asked to enter number of keywords to subscribe for. ZERO is entered if there is no preference. If preference is given, only those tweets with the entered keywords is subscribed.
-
OnStatus function is called every time a tweet is obtained.
-
Text is extracted from Tweet and Hashtag is extracted from text using Regex.
-
HashTag is stored in a queue that is of size 50000. The size can be increased or decreased.
-
Count of each Hashtag stored in queue is maintained in a hash map.
-
Decrease count of a hashtag when removed from queue and similarly increase count when added to the queue.
-
Maintain a heap that contains top-k hashtags i.e. k hashtags with highest counts. A comparator is used to compare elements in heap. This comparator compares elements based on their counts in the map.
-
Every 5 seconds, the heap is printed to see the top k elements. In our case k = 10.
